From:
Henry Warburton
To:
Sir John Herschel
Date:
[20 December 1847]
Source of text:
RS:HS 18.49
Summary:

Verified Leonhard Euler's values for Bernoulli's numbers up to B=25 by method previously outlined and to be stated fully in this letter. Mr. Hensley [of Trinity College] proposes to revise incorrect values given in Penny Cyclopaedia. Computing a Bernoulli number by P. S. Laplace's formula takes three days. HW's method of continued subtraction requires only 24 hours.

From:
Henry Warburton
To:
Sir John Herschel
Date:
[23 December 1847]
Source of text:
RS:HS 18.50
Summary:

Proved accuracy of Leonhard Euler's values for Bernoulli's 27th number. Plans to test number 29. Will investigate Thomas Clausen's theorem, the generality of which JH appears to have disproved.
